24 January 1983 Docket 50-187 United States Nuclear Regulatory Cormiission Region V 1450 Maria Lane, Suite 210 Walnut Creek, CA. 94596 Attention:

F. A. Wenslawski, Chief Reactor Radiation Protection Section

Subject:

Reply to Notice of Two Item of Noncompliance Gentlemen:

In accordance with Section 2.201 of NRC's " Rules of Practice", Part 2, Title 10, Code of Federal Regulations, this letter is written to explain and to describe the cotrective action taken to prevent any further viola-tions as noted in your letter of 24 November 1982.

Violation B B.

Technical Specification, Section H.3 a" Operating Procedures" states in part that:

" Written instructions shall be in effect for:

a) Testing and calibration of reactor operating instrumentation and contral systems, control rod drives, area radiation monitors and air particulate monitors.

Contrary to the above requirement, at the time of this inspection no approved written instructions existed for accomplishing the calibration of area radia-tion monitors and the air particulate monitor.

(1)

The corrective steps which have been taken and the results achieved:

The problem has been reviewed, and appropriate information and data has been obtained.

Review of this material is under way, which will allow the writing of a calibration procedure.

(2)

The corrective steps which will be taken to avoid further items of noncompliance:

Procedures will be written and approved for calibra-tion of the area radiation monitor and the air particulate monitor.

F. A. Wenslawski, Chief Page l Reactor Rad. Protection Section (3) The date when full compliance will be achieved:

25 April 1983.

Violation A A.

Technical Specifications, Section F.2.3 & 4 " Radiation Monitoring" requires at least one area radiation monitor, a continuous air monitor and a continuous gas stack monitor be operable during reactor operations. Section F.4 states in part that this instru-mentation shall be calibrated at least once a year.

Contrary to the above requirement, at the time of this inspection the annual calibration of the area radiation monitor and the continuous air monitor had not been accomplished during 1980, 1981 or 1982.

(1) The corrective steps which have been taken, and the results achieved:

A total calibration is being written to achieve this requirement as per corrective steps Violation B.

(2) Corrective steps which will be taken to avoid further items of non-ompliance: Once the written procedure is approved and in place, this calibration procedure will be carried out on the area radiation monitor and the air particulate monitor.

(3) The date whor, full compliance will be achieved: 9 May 1983.
